Output 1d5bc1f4b3d1f5c2eff741a4be0ea3313f941d96acc22db3a598a295119dbaae:0

value
307956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64f98fbae567ecaef632104abc1ad137ccd2fc71 OP_EQUAL
address
3AtvTZSAT1uAEeXi3nTZGN8Yih3MpL75cA
transaction
1d5bc1f4b3d1f5c2eff741a4be0ea3313f941d96acc22db3a598a295119dbaae
confirmations
190492
spent
true